Never put mirrors in these three places in your house, according to Feng Shui

Feng Shui, the ancient Chinese practice of arranging spaces to promote balance and well-being, teaches that mirrors do more than reflect light—they also reflect and direct energy. Where you place a mirror can influence the flow of that energy, affecting your home’s harmony, prosperity, and even emotional health.

Placed correctly, mirrors can expand space and attract positivity. Placed incorrectly, they may block good fortune, slow financial flow, or create emotional unrest.

Below are three locations where Feng Shui experts advise never placing a mirror if you want to protect balance and abundance in your home.

1. In Front of the Bed

Positioning a mirror directly across from your bed is considered one of the most disruptive mistakes in Feng Shui. When you sleep, your body and mind enter a state of deep energy regeneration. A mirror in this position can disturb that process.

Potential effects:

  • Restless sleep or insomnia
  • Heightened stress or anxiety
  • Strain in romantic relationships
  • A persistent feeling of being watched

Some Feng Shui traditions also hold that mirrors opposite the bed can “reflect the soul” during sleep, creating an energetic split that leaves you feeling unsettled.

What to do: If moving the mirror is not possible, cover it at night with a decorative fabric or screen.

2. Directly Facing the Main Door

The main entrance is considered the primary channel through which vital energy, or Chi, flows into your home. A mirror placed directly opposite the door is believed to bounce that energy right back outside—along with potential prosperity, love, and opportunities.

Possible consequences:

  • Financial setbacks or losses
  • Stalled personal or professional progress
  • Difficulty attracting new opportunities

What to do: Hang the mirror on a side wall in the entryway, rather than directly across from the door, to preserve the flow of positive energy into your home.

3. In Front of a Work or Study Desk

Your desk is the focal point for productivity, creativity, and concentration. A mirror placed directly in front of it can scatter your focus, reflecting your energy away from your tasks instead of channeling it toward your goals.

Negative effects:

  • Difficulty concentrating
  • Mental fatigue
  • Delayed or unfinished projects

What to do:
If you want to brighten the space, position the mirror to the side rather than directly in front of you. Alternatively, replace it with décor that inspires stability and motivation, such as plants, wooden elements, or artwork.

The Energy You Reflect Matters

Mirrors not only reflect physical images—they also reflect emotional energy. Poorly placed mirrors can amplify stress, worry, or conflict, just as easily as they can enhance light and beauty. Thoughtful placement ensures they support, rather than disrupt, the harmony of your home.

When used wisely, mirrors can be powerful tools for expanding space, attracting abundance, and creating an environment that nurtures both body and mind.
